A Back to School Girls’ Night Out
Hot Young Professionals, Hotter Fashions and a Righteous Cause Come Together
By Anne Lee Phillips //
Photography Jenny Antill Clifton
What: Breakthrough Houston Night Out
Where: Alice and Olivia in River Oaks District
Who: Chairs Carolyn Dorros (she, the chair of Breakthrough Houston Advisory Council), Jennie Segal, and Molly Voorhees; Laura Arnold, Vidya Bala, Viviana Denechaud, Jamil and Carter Higley, Allison Leibman, Jennifer Laporte, Liz Stephanian, and Courtney Toomey.
PC Moment: Mini bottles of bubbly were popping left and right as the style set learned about Breakthrough Houston‘s most successful summer program ever and stocked up on fashions from the ’70s-inspired fall collection, knowing that 20 percent of the evening’s sales benefitted the education nonprofit that aids underserved, high-performing Houston youth.
